Reader’s Question:

I am required to get an SR22 in Florida, what is it?

 

Like in any other states, you will be required by the state of Florida to get an SR22 for many reasons. An SR22 insurance in Florida shows proof that you have the require minimum liability insurance required by the state. The state of Florida requires that you get the minimum insurance requirement of:

  • $10,000 – Personal Injury Protection
  • $10,000 – Property Damage Liability
If you got involved in an accident and you do not have car insurance coverage required by the state, your drivers license will be suspended and you will be required t obtain an SR22. Generally, an SR22 insurance will need to be maintained for around 3 years. Please contact Florida Highway Safety and Motor Vehicles to get more information.

Once you have been required to obtain SR22 insurance, you will need to keep it, otherwise, you will penalized. Failure to file an SR22 insurance may result in suspension of driving privilege and suspension of license plate.

Steps on How to Buy SR22 Insurance in Florida

Unfortunately, you probably aren’t famous, so we’ll have to walk through the steps of buying an SR22 policy from a Florida no fault car insurance company by ourselves. It’s a simple practice which can be completed in a few minutes, but since it sometimes takes a couple of weeks to have the SR22 filed, make sure you get on it as soon as possible so as not to have your driver’s license suspended again.

1. Pick up the phone and dial your Florida no fault car insurance company or agent. Tell them that you’ll have to purchase an SR22 policy in order to get your license reinstated. They can walk you through the process.

2. Get quoted. Once you’ve contacted your Florida no fault car insurance company, they’ll take another look at your risk. This will include a new quote, and it also might involve having the door slammed in your face. Once you are required to file an SR22 form, your no fault Florida car insurance company might not want to insure you any longer, and you’ll have to start looking again.

3. Pick your coverage. SR22 filing is expensive, or at least the risk rating associated with it is, so if I were you I would stick to the minimum coverage, which at the moment is just liability. Once January comes around, you’ll have to call your no fault Florida car insurance company up and ask them to add no fault coverage to it. If you do purchase collision insurance, the prices will be phenomenal.

4. If your car insurance company cancels your policy, you can either try to find a company that insures high risk drivers, or you can join the Florida assigned risk pool, which randomly assigns you to a no fault Florida car insurance company.

5. Pay up and get going. In some cases, you can download your SR22 form or send it online, or the car insurance company will mail it to you so you can take it to the department of motor vehicles. In other cases, the no fault Florida car insurance company will do so itself.
